Peterson Park is a small neighborhood park located in Omaha, Nebraska along the banks of West Papillion Creek. This park has a picnic shelter, a small soccer field, a half basketball court, and a playground for the kids. Come out and have fun!

Omaha Park Rules
*All motorized vehicles must stay on roads and in designated parking areas.
*All dogs must be leashed and waste removed.
*Horseback riding only allowed in designated areas.
*Posting of signs or flyers or any type of advertisement on park property whether it be trees, playgrounds, telephone poles, fences, etc, is stricly prohibited.
*The following activities require special permits; setting off fireworks, soliciting, consumption of alcoholic beverages, public assemblies, swimming.
*All firearms are prohibited on park rounds (except for on-duty law enforcement officers).
*If you asked by one of the staff to leave, you are required to leave.
*Unless given special permission from park's director, all games and sports must be played in their designated areas.
*With the exception of persons with disabilities, no person between the ages of 16 and 62 may fish on park property. The exception to this rule is at Dodge Memorial Park.
*Violators of these laws will be prosecuted.
